Maryland Statutes

§ 18-805

Maryland·Article gab Alcoholic Beverages and Cannabis·Title 18
(a)There is a Class H beer and light wine license.
(b)The license authorizes the license holder to sell beer and light wine at a hotel or restaurant, at retail, at the place described in the license, for on–premises consumption.
(c)(1) The annual license fee is $340.
(2)A license holder shall pay, in addition to the annual license fee:
(i)$200, if the license holder provides live entertainment; and
(ii)$200, if the license holder provides outdoor table service.
